Het is 1193 voor Christus. Paris, de prins van Troje, wordt verliefd op Helena, koningin van Sparta, en Helena gaat met hem mee naar Troje, zonder dat haar echtgenoot, koning Menelaos, dat weet. Dit zorgt er voor dat beide koninkrijken in oorlog met elkaar raken. Er vindt een bloedig slagveld plaats rond Troje. Achilles was de grootste held bij de Grieken, terwijl Hector, de oudste zoon van de koning van Troje, de hoop van de inwoners van zijn stad was.

  • EnochLight20 januari 2025
    They don't make sword and sandal flicks like this anymore. TROY is beautifully shot, and Petersen's more realistic take on this legendary war epic is a sight to behold. There are no subtextual conversations from the POV of Zeus, Hera, or any of the other various Gods of Olympus. The film is from the POV of the mortals who loved, fought, and died in Homer's epic, and in doing so - Petersen grounds the film in a world that feels "real". Brad Pitt seems like he was born to play Achilles, as was Eric Bana playing Hector. Orlando Bloom, fresh off of Lord of the Rings, portrays a splendid Paris, and Brian Cox as Agamemnon was a brilliant choice. Peter O'Toole as Priam couldn't have been better, and Brendan Gleeson, Diane Kruger, and Rose Byrne all bring their A-game. If I had any complaint, it's that I would have loved to have seen Sean Bean as Odysseus in a follow-up in The Odyssey, but that ship has long sailed to Ithaca. On that note, I am very much looking forward to what Christopher Nolan does with The Odyssey (hoping he keeps the mythological/supernatural elements). Overall, TROY is underappreciated and a fantastic piece of film history. Highly recommended!
